DNS Flag Day Outcomes Policy Effectiveness and Future Steps
- by Staff
The Domain Name System (DNS) serves as the backbone of internet functionality, enabling the resolution of domain names into IP addresses and facilitating seamless connectivity. Over time, as the internet has grown in scale and complexity, challenges in maintaining and upgrading the DNS have become increasingly evident. To address these issues, the concept of DNS Flag Day was introduced as a coordinated effort to improve DNS performance, security, and compliance by addressing outdated practices and ensuring adherence to modern standards. The outcomes of DNS Flag Days, their policy effectiveness, and the steps required to build on their successes provide critical insights into the evolution of DNS governance and its future trajectory.
DNS Flag Day is a community-driven initiative aimed at addressing long-standing technical debt in the DNS ecosystem. Each DNS Flag Day focuses on specific areas where non-compliant or outdated behaviors impede the efficiency, security, or interoperability of the DNS. By setting a fixed date for enforcing changes, DNS Flag Days incentivize operators, administrators, and vendors to update their systems, test compliance, and adopt best practices. This coordinated approach reduces fragmentation and promotes alignment across the global DNS infrastructure.
One of the key outcomes of DNS Flag Day has been the enhancement of DNS compliance with established standards. For example, the 2019 DNS Flag Day targeted the elimination of workarounds for non-compliant EDNS (Extension Mechanisms for DNS) implementations. EDNS extends DNS functionality by allowing larger message sizes, additional features, and future extensibility. Non-compliant systems that failed to support EDNS correctly caused inefficiencies and hindered the adoption of advanced DNS features. By discontinuing workarounds and requiring strict adherence to EDNS standards, the 2019 initiative improved DNS resolution performance and paved the way for further innovations, such as DNS cookies and client subnet extensions.
Another significant outcome of DNS Flag Day initiatives has been the improvement of security and resilience within the DNS ecosystem. Subsequent events, such as the 2020 DNS Flag Day, focused on issues like DNS resolver behaviors and improved handling of DNS queries. These efforts addressed vulnerabilities and inefficiencies that could be exploited by attackers, such as amplification attacks or cache poisoning. By promoting the adoption of secure practices and technologies, DNS Flag Day initiatives have contributed to a more robust and trustworthy DNS infrastructure, benefiting users and stakeholders across the internet.
The policy effectiveness of DNS Flag Day lies in its collaborative and inclusive approach. By bringing together key stakeholders, including DNS software developers, operators, vendors, and standards organizations, DNS Flag Days ensure broad participation and alignment. This multistakeholder model facilitates the exchange of knowledge, identification of pain points, and consensus on actionable solutions. Moreover, the fixed timeline provides a clear incentive for stakeholders to prioritize updates and compliance efforts, reducing delays and fostering a sense of collective responsibility.
While DNS Flag Day has yielded positive outcomes, challenges remain in achieving universal compliance and addressing the diverse needs of the DNS community. One recurring issue is the variability in readiness among stakeholders. While some operators and vendors quickly adopt changes and align with new standards, others may face resource constraints, technical limitations, or lack of awareness, leading to uneven implementation. This disparity can result in temporary disruptions, interoperability issues, or resistance to future changes. Policies must account for these challenges by providing adequate support, education, and transitional mechanisms to facilitate widespread adoption.
The future of DNS Flag Day and similar initiatives requires a forward-looking approach to policy development and implementation. Emerging trends, such as the adoption of encrypted DNS protocols like DNS over HTTPS (DoH) and DNS over TLS (DoT), highlight the need for continued updates to DNS infrastructure and practices. Future DNS Flag Days could address areas such as improved support for privacy-enhancing technologies, streamlined management of DNSSEC keys, or expanded capabilities for secure and efficient DNS query resolution.
To build on the successes of DNS Flag Day, policymakers and stakeholders should focus on fostering a culture of proactive engagement and continuous improvement within the DNS community. This includes investing in research and development to anticipate future challenges, enhancing communication and outreach efforts to raise awareness among less active participants, and maintaining a commitment to transparency and accountability. By addressing these areas, DNS Flag Day can continue to serve as a catalyst for positive change, driving the evolution of the DNS in alignment with the needs of a dynamic and interconnected world.
In conclusion, DNS Flag Day represents a transformative approach to addressing challenges in the DNS ecosystem through coordinated policy enforcement and collaboration. The outcomes of these initiatives, including improved compliance, enhanced security, and greater operational efficiency, underscore their value in maintaining a resilient and effective DNS infrastructure. As the internet continues to evolve, the principles and practices established by DNS Flag Day will play an essential role in guiding the development of future policies and ensuring the DNS remains a cornerstone of the global internet.
The Domain Name System (DNS) serves as the backbone of internet functionality, enabling the resolution of domain names into IP addresses and facilitating seamless connectivity. Over time, as the internet has grown in scale and complexity, challenges in maintaining and upgrading the DNS have become increasingly evident. To address these issues, the concept of DNS…